Nosebleed Posted December 17, 2015 Posted December 17, 2015 It's just, the story didn't feel like it went anywhere from where season 2 ended, that's why when they ended pretty much the same way season 2 did, it didn't feel like much was accomplished, that's the "needless" factor for me. The very last scene was good, but everything before it was basically a rehash of everything they've already done before with nothing to make it more fun.I'd much rather have just seen a movie where they have fun, like the K-on movie, instead of dabbling on about graduating for over an hour, something that was already covered in season 2 and, imo, shouldn't have been the central theme of the movie.(spoilers below) Think about it, what did the movie accomplish exactly?After technically graduating, they went to NY for a promotional event.They suddenly go viral due to itThey decide to have just one last concertThey have a huge concert, then they finally graduate This is basically the same thing the second season did:They remind each other that they're graduatingDecide to aim to win the Love Live competitionThey train extra hardThey winThey graduate (but at the very end annouce there's still more, which segways into the movie) They're essentially the same thing, except in the movie most of it was shrouded in drama revolving around the graduation, which was something that already happened in season 2, and that to me cut a lot of the potential the movie had to just let the characters do new things or even just have fun, there was barely any remarkable scene during their trip to NY, it was such a waste So the movie was just a more watered down and extended version of season 2's last episodes in terms of themes. It wasn't a terrible movie though, it did what Love Live already does for the most part, I just didn't feel like it met my expectations/hype, especially when they had 1 hour and a half to do so much stuff but they decide to stick to the formula anyway.
